What is Sign PDF?

PDFBasic's Sign PDF tool lets you add your signature to any PDF document digitally — no printing, signing, and scanning required. Draw your signature using your mouse or touchscreen, type your name in a signature font, or upload an image of your handwritten signature. Place it precisely on the document, resize it, and download the signed PDF instantly.

How to Use Sign PDF Online

Upload your PDF, then create your signature: draw it with your mouse/finger, type your name in a signature font, or upload a signature image. Position the signature anywhere on the document by dragging it. Resize as needed, then click "Apply & Download."

When Should You Use Sign PDF?

Sign PDFs when you need to sign contracts, agreements, or legal documents remotely; authorize purchase orders and invoices; sign permission forms and consent documents; or add your approval to reports and proposals.

Pro Tips

  • Draw signatures with a stylus or finger on touch devices for the most natural look
  • Use a dark background when uploading a signature image (white background works best)
  • Save your signature for reuse across multiple documents

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Signing the wrong page or wrong location — preview carefully
  • Using a very small signature that isn't legible
  • Forgetting to flatten the PDF after signing for security
